About this episode
When South African model Reeva Steenkamp was shot and killed by Olympian Oscar Pistorius, the world struggled to understand what really happened that tragic night. Morgan and Kaelyn dive into crucial clues, including neighbors' testimonies, clothing mysteries, troubling texts, and Oscar’s own volatile behavior.
